(Insider Stories) - A plan by Wilmar International and Noble Group Ltd. to set up a palm plantation in Papua has stalled after the companies failed to receive permits.
The companies, planned to produce and sell crude palm oil and its derivatives, have set up a joint venture that holds a majority stake in PT Henrison Inti Persada, which owns around 23,000 hectares of land in Papua.
“The Wilmar-Noble JV is off the table as certain relevant merger clearances were not received (before a deadline)," a Wilmar spokeswoman was cited by Reuters as saying on Tuesday.
